Where is Madonna di Campiglio?

Madonna di Campiglio is the leading resort in the Brenta Dolomites and the heart of the Campiglio Dolomiti di Brenta Ski Area, one of the largest ski regions in Europe.

The resort offers ski-in/ski-out connections with Pinzolo and Folgarida-Marilleva, hundreds of kilometres of ski slopes, modern lift systems, and some of the finest hospitality available in the Italian Alps.

Where is Canazei Located?

Canazei is located in Val di Fassa, in the heart of the UNESCO-listed Dolomites, and is one of the most sought-after destinations for skiing, snowboarding, and mountain holidays.

The resort offers direct access to the Sellaronda and the Belvedere–Col Rodella ski area.

3. Train and Bus

It is possible to reach Canazei by combining:

  • a train to Trento or Bolzano;
  • a bus service to Val di Fassa.

This option generally involves multiple connections and longer travel times.
